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49142322 65115 190 53225607
172270202 5958852 5774948
172270202 5958852 5774948
7522748179 871630 017295 097
All about undefined
Interested in learning more?
172270202 5958852 5774948
7522748179 871630 017295 097
See more
0698496 45 50659905
1131 10886469538 787
See more
64 3124015209
9540863373 9846 4537 46 008858
See more